1from __future__ import annotations 2 3import typing as t 4 5from sqlglot import exp, generator, parser, tokens 6from sqlglot.dialects.dialect import Dialect, inline_array_sql, var_map_sql 7from sqlglot.errors import ParseError 8from sqlglot.parser import parse_var_map 9from sqlglot.tokens import TokenType 10 11 12def _lower_func(sql: str) -> str: 13 index = sql.index("(") 14 return sql[:index].lower() + sql[index:] 15 16 17class ClickHouse(Dialect): 18 normalize_functions = None 19 null_ordering = "nulls_are_last" 20 21 class Tokenizer(tokens.Tokenizer): 22 COMMENTS = ["--", "#", "#!", ("/*", "*/")] 23 IDENTIFIERS = ['"', "`"] 24 25 KEYWORDS = { 26 **tokens.Tokenizer.KEYWORDS, 27 "ASOF": TokenType.ASOF, 28 "GLOBAL": TokenType.GLOBAL, 29 "DATETIME64": TokenType.DATETIME, 30 "FINAL": TokenType.FINAL, 31 "FLOAT32": TokenType.FLOAT, 32 "FLOAT64": TokenType.DOUBLE, 33 "INT16": TokenType.SMALLINT, 34 "INT32": TokenType.INT, 35 "INT64": TokenType.BIGINT, 36 "INT8": TokenType.TINYINT, 37 "TUPLE": TokenType.STRUCT, 38 } 39 40 class Parser(parser.Parser): 41 FUNCTIONS = { 42 **parser.Parser.FUNCTIONS, # type: ignore 43 "MAP": parse_var_map, 44 "QUANTILE": lambda params, args: exp.Quantile(this=args, quantile=params), 45 "QUANTILES": lambda params, args: exp.Quantiles(parameters=params, expressions=args), 46 "QUANTILEIF": lambda params, args: exp.QuantileIf(parameters=params, expressions=args), 47 } 48 49 RANGE_PARSERS = { 50 **parser.Parser.RANGE_PARSERS, 51 TokenType.GLOBAL: lambda self, this: self._match(TokenType.IN) 52 and self._parse_in(this, is_global=True), 53 } 54 55 JOIN_KINDS = {*parser.Parser.JOIN_KINDS, TokenType.ANY, TokenType.ASOF} # type: ignore 56 57 TABLE_ALIAS_TOKENS = {*parser.Parser.TABLE_ALIAS_TOKENS} - {TokenType.ANY} # type: ignore 58 59 def _parse_in( 60 self, this: t.Optional[exp.Expression], is_global: bool = False 61 ) -> exp.Expression: 62 this = super()._parse_in(this) 63 this.set("is_global", is_global) 64 return this 65 66 def _parse_table( 67 self, schema: bool = False, alias_tokens: t.Optional[t.Collection[TokenType]] = None 68 ) -> t.Optional[exp.Expression]: 69 this = super()._parse_table(schema=schema, alias_tokens=alias_tokens) 70 71 if self._match(TokenType.FINAL): 72 this = self.expression(exp.Final, this=this) 73 74 return this 75 76 def _parse_position(self, haystack_first: bool = False) -> exp.Expression: 77 return super()._parse_position(haystack_first=True) 78 79 # https://clickhouse.com/docs/en/sql-reference/statements/select/with/ 80 def _parse_cte(self) -> exp.Expression: 81 index = self._index 82 try: 83 # WITH <identifier> AS <subquery expression> 84 return super()._parse_cte() 85 except ParseError: 86 # WITH <expression> AS <identifier> 87 self._retreat(index) 88 statement = self._parse_statement() 89 90 if statement and isinstance(statement.this, exp.Alias): 91 self.raise_error("Expected CTE to have alias") 92 93 return self.expression(exp.CTE, this=statement, alias=statement and statement.this) 94 95 class Generator(generator.Generator): 96 STRUCT_DELIMITER = ("(", ")") 97 98 TYPE_MAPPING = { 99 **generator.Generator.TYPE_MAPPING, # type: ignore 100 exp.DataType.Type.NULLABLE: "Nullable", 101 exp.DataType.Type.DATETIME: "DateTime64", 102 exp.DataType.Type.MAP: "Map", 103 exp.DataType.Type.ARRAY: "Array", 104 exp.DataType.Type.STRUCT: "Tuple", 105 exp.DataType.Type.TINYINT: "Int8", 106 exp.DataType.Type.SMALLINT: "Int16", 107 exp.DataType.Type.INT: "Int32", 108 exp.DataType.Type.BIGINT: "Int64", 109 exp.DataType.Type.FLOAT: "Float32", 110 exp.DataType.Type.DOUBLE: "Float64", 111 } 112 113 TRANSFORMS = { 114 **generator.Generator.TRANSFORMS, # type: ignore 115 exp.Array: inline_array_sql, 116 exp.StrPosition: lambda self, e: f"position({self.format_args(e.this, e.args.get('substr'), e.args.get('position'))})", 117 exp.Final: lambda self, e: f"{self.sql(e, 'this')} FINAL", 118 exp.Map: lambda self, e: _lower_func(var_map_sql(self, e)), 119 exp.VarMap: lambda self, e: _lower_func(var_map_sql(self, e)), 120 exp.Quantile: lambda self, e: f"quantile{self._param_args_sql(e, 'quantile', 'this')}", 121 exp.Quantiles: lambda self, e: f"quantiles{self._param_args_sql(e, 'parameters', 'expressions')}", 122 exp.QuantileIf: lambda self, e: f"quantileIf{self._param_args_sql(e, 'parameters', 'expressions')}", 123 } 124 125 EXPLICIT_UNION = True 126 127 def _param_args_sql( 128 self, expression: exp.Expression, params_name: str, args_name: str 129 ) -> str: 130 params = self.format_args(self.expressions(expression, params_name)) 131 args = self.format_args(self.expressions(expression, args_name)) 132 return f"({params})({args})" 133 134 def cte_sql(self, expression: exp.CTE) -> str: 135 if isinstance(expression.this, exp.Alias): 136 return self.sql(expression, "this") 137 138 return super().cte_sql(expression)

Parser consumes a list of tokens produced by the sqlglot.tokens.Tokenizer
and produces
a parsed syntax tree.
Arguments:
- error_level: the desired error level. Default: ErrorLevel.RAISE
- error_message_context: determines the amount of context to capture from a query string when displaying the error message (in number of characters). Default: 50.
- index_offset: Index offset for arrays eg ARRAY[0] vs ARRAY[1] as the head of a list. Default: 0
- alias_post_tablesample: If the table alias comes after tablesample. Default: False
- max_errors: Maximum number of error messages to include in a raised ParseError. This is only relevant if error_level is ErrorLevel.RAISE. Default: 3
- null_ordering: Indicates the default null ordering method to use if not explicitly set. Options are "nulls_are_small", "nulls_are_large", "nulls_are_last". Default: "nulls_are_small"

Generator interprets the given syntax tree and produces a SQL string as an output.
Arguments:
- time_mapping (dict): the dictionary of custom time mappings in which the key represents a python time format and the output the target time format
- time_trie (trie): a trie of the time_mapping keys
- pretty (bool): if set to True the returned string will be formatted. Default: False.
- quote_start (str): specifies which starting character to use to delimit quotes. Default: '.
- quote_end (str): specifies which ending character to use to delimit quotes. Default: '.
- identifier_start (str): specifies which starting character to use to delimit identifiers. Default: ".
- identifier_end (str): specifies which ending character to use to delimit identifiers. Default: ".
- identify (bool | str): 'always': always quote, 'safe': quote identifiers if they don't contain an upcase, True defaults to always.
- normalize (bool): if set to True all identifiers will lower cased
- string_escape (str): specifies a string escape character. Default: '.
- identifier_escape (str): specifies an identifier escape character. Default: ".
- pad (int): determines padding in a formatted string. Default: 2.
- indent (int): determines the size of indentation in a formatted string. Default: 4.
- unnest_column_only (bool): if true unnest table aliases are considered only as column aliases
- normalize_functions (str): normalize function names, "upper", "lower", or None Default: "upper"
- alias_post_tablesample (bool): if the table alias comes after tablesample Default: False
- unsupported_level (ErrorLevel): determines the generator's behavior when it encounters unsupported expressions. Default ErrorLevel.WARN.
- null_ordering (str): Indicates the default null ordering method to use if not explicitly set. Options are "nulls_are_small", "nulls_are_large", "nulls_are_last". Default: "nulls_are_small"
- max_unsupported (int): Maximum number of unsupported messages to include in a raised UnsupportedError. This is only relevant if unsupported_level is ErrorLevel.RAISE. Default: 3
- leading_comma (bool): if the the comma is leading or trailing in select statements Default: False
- max_text_width: The max number of characters in a segment before creating new lines in pretty mode. The default is on the smaller end because the length only represents a segment and not the true line length. Default: 80
- comments: Whether or not to preserve comments in the output SQL code. Default: True
